465 void CodeGenFunction::EmitAggregateClear(llvm::Value *DestPtr, QualType Ty) {
466   assert(!Ty->isAnyComplexType() && "Shouldn't happen for complex");
467 
468   EmitMemSetToZero(DestPtr, Ty);
469 }
470 
471 void CodeGenFunction::EmitAggregateCopy(llvm::Value *DestPtr,
472                                         llvm::Value *SrcPtr, QualType Ty) {
473   assert(!Ty->isAnyComplexType() && "Shouldn't happen for complex");
474 
475   // Aggregate assignment turns into llvm.memcpy.  This is almost valid per
476   // C99 6.5.16.1p3, which states "If the value being stored in an object is
477   // read from another object that overlaps in anyway the storage of the first
478   // object, then the overlap shall be exact and the two objects shall have
479   // qualified or unqualified versions of a compatible type."
480   //
481   // memcpy is not defined if the source and destination pointers are exactly
482   // equal, but other compilers do this optimization, and almost every memcpy
483   // implementation handles this case safely.  If there is a libc that does not
484   // safely handle this, we can add a target hook.
485   const llvm::Type *BP = llvm::PointerType::getUnqual(llvm::Type::Int8Ty);
486   if (DestPtr->getType() != BP)
487     DestPtr = Builder.CreateBitCast(DestPtr, BP, "tmp");
488   if (SrcPtr->getType() != BP)
489     SrcPtr = Builder.CreateBitCast(SrcPtr, BP, "tmp");
490 
491   // Get size and alignment info for this aggregate.
492   std::pair<uint64_t, unsigned> TypeInfo = getContext().getTypeInfo(Ty);
493 
494   // FIXME: Handle variable sized types.
495   const llvm::Type *IntPtr = llvm::IntegerType::get(LLVMPointerWidth);
496 
497   Builder.CreateCall4(CGM.getMemCpyFn(),
498                       DestPtr, SrcPtr,
499                       // TypeInfo.first describes size in bits.
500                       llvm::ConstantInt::get(IntPtr, TypeInfo.first/8),
501                       llvm::ConstantInt::get(llvm::Type::Int32Ty,
502                                              TypeInfo.second/8));
503 }
